
Cara Kerja Website Surabaya
Cara kerja website di Surabaya merupakan hal yang menarik untuk dipahami, terutama bagi para pengusaha dan individu yang ingin memanfaatkan teknologi digital untuk keperluan bisnis dan informasi. Dalam artikel ini, kita akan menjelaskan prinsip dasar di balik cara kerja sebuah website, termasuk komponen-komponen penting yang terlibat dalam prosesnya.
Kami akan membahas bagaimana server, domain, dan hosting berinteraksi untuk menyajikan konten kepada pengguna, serta bagaimana website dapat diakses melalui berbagai perangkat. Dengan pemahaman yang lebih baik mengenai cara kerja website, Anda akan lebih siap untuk mengoptimalkan kehadiran online Anda di era digital ini.
Mari kita simak lebih lanjut tentang cara kerja website di Surabaya
Prinsip Dasar Cara Kerja Sebuah Website
Website adalah kumpulan halaman yang dapat diakses melalui internet, dan cara kerjanya melibatkan beberapa komponen dan proses dasar. Berikut adalah penjelasan mengenai prinsip dasar cara kerja sebuah website:
Server dan Hosting
Website disimpan di server, yang merupakan komputer yang selalu terhubung ke internet. Server ini menyimpan semua file yang diperlukan untuk website, termasuk halaman HTML, gambar, dan skrip. Ketika seseorang mengakses website, server mengirimkan file-file ini ke perangkat pengguna.
Domain dan Alamat IP
Setiap website memiliki nama domain (misalnya, www.contoh.com) yang memudahkan pengguna untuk mengingatnya. Nama domain ini terhubung dengan alamat IP (Internet Protocol) yang merupakan serangkaian angka yang mengidentifikasi lokasi server di internet. Ketika pengguna memasukkan nama domain di browser, permintaan akan diteruskan ke server yang sesuai.
Proses Permintaan dan Respon
Ketika pengguna mengakses website, browser mengirimkan permintaan ke server untuk mengakses halaman tertentu. Server kemudian memproses permintaan ini dan mengirimkan respon kembali ke browser, yang berisi file-file yang diperlukan untuk menampilkan halaman tersebut.
HTML, CSS, dan JavaScript
Website dibangun menggunakan berbagai bahasa pemrograman, dengan HTML (HyperText Markup Language) sebagai struktur dasar, CSS (Cascading Style Sheets) untuk styling dan tata letak, serta JavaScript untuk interaktivitas. Ketiga elemen ini bekerja sama untuk menciptakan tampilan dan fungsi website.
Content Management System (CMS)
Banyak website menggunakan Content Management System (CMS) untuk memudahkan pengelolaan konten. CMS memungkinkan pengguna untuk membuat, mengedit, dan mengatur konten tanpa perlu memahami kode pemrograman secara mendalam. Ini sangat berguna bagi pemilik bisnis yang ingin mengelola website mereka sendiri.
Keamanan dan Pemeliharaan
Website juga memerlukan keamanan untuk melindungi data pengguna dan mencegah serangan siber. Ini termasuk penggunaan protokol HTTPS, pembaruan rutin, dan pengelolaan akses pengguna. Selain itu, pemeliharaan berkala diperlukan untuk memastikan website tetap berfungsi dengan baik dan relevan.
Dengan memahami prinsip dasar cara kerja sebuah website, Anda dapat lebih mudah merancang, mengelola, dan memasarkan website bisnis Anda. Ini juga membantu dalam mengatasi masalah teknis yang mungkin muncul di kemudian hari.
Komponen-Komponen Penting dalam Proses Cara Kerja Website di Surabaya
Membangun dan menjalankan sebuah website melibatkan beberapa komponen penting yang bekerja sama untuk memastikan website berfungsi dengan baik. Berikut adalah komponen-komponen tersebut:
Domain
Domain adalah alamat unik yang digunakan untuk mengakses website Anda di internet. Misalnya, www.namasitus.com. Memilih nama domain yang tepat sangat penting untuk branding dan kemudahan diingat oleh pengunjung.
Hosting
Hosting adalah layanan yang menyediakan ruang di server untuk menyimpan semua file website Anda. Tanpa hosting, website Anda tidak dapat diakses oleh pengguna. Ada berbagai jenis hosting, seperti shared hosting, VPS, dan dedicated hosting, yang dapat dipilih sesuai kebutuhan.
Server
Server adalah komputer yang menyimpan data website dan mengirimkan informasi tersebut ke pengguna saat mereka mengakses website. Komponen ini bertanggung jawab untuk memproses permintaan dari browser dan mengirimkan halaman yang diminta.
Content Management System (CMS)
CMS adalah platform yang memungkinkan pengguna untuk membuat, mengedit, dan mengelola konten website tanpa perlu memahami kode pemrograman. Contoh CMS yang populer adalah WordPress, Joomla, dan Drupal. CMS memudahkan pemilik bisnis untuk memperbarui website mereka secara berkala.
Bahasa Pemrograman
Website dibangun menggunakan berbagai bahasa pemrograman seperti HTML, CSS, dan JavaScript. HTML digunakan untuk struktur halaman, CSS untuk styling, dan JavaScript untuk interaktivitas. Kombinasi ketiga bahasa ini menciptakan pengalaman pengguna yang menarik.
Database
Database menyimpan data yang diperlukan oleh website, seperti informasi pengguna, konten, dan pengaturan. Komponen database memungkinkan website untuk menyimpan dan mengambil data dengan efisien. MySQL dan PostgreSQL adalah contoh sistem manajemen database yang umum digunakan.
Keamanan
Aspek keamanan sangat penting untuk melindungi website dari serangan siber. Ini termasuk penggunaan protokol HTTPS, firewall, dan pembaruan rutin untuk perangkat lunak. Keamanan yang baik membantu menjaga data pengguna dan reputasi bisnis.
Desain dan User Experience (UX)
Desain website dan pengalaman pengguna (UX) adalah faktor kunci dalam menarik dan mempertahankan pengunjung. Website yang memiliki desain menarik dan navigasi yang intuitif akan membuat pengunjung betah dan meningkatkan kemungkinan mereka untuk kembali.
Analitik dan Pemantauan
Menggunakan alat analitik seperti Google Analytics membantu pemilik website untuk memantau pengunjung, perilaku pengguna, dan kinerja website. Data ini sangat berguna untuk mengoptimalkan strategi pemasaran dan meningkatkan pengalaman pengguna.
Dengan memahami komponen-komponen penting ini, Anda dapat lebih efektif dalam membangun dan mengelola website bisnis Anda di Surabaya, serta memastikan bahwa website tersebut berfungsi dengan baik dan memenuhi kebutuhan pengguna.